Auto-provisioning web services
MaaS360® eases the generation of the authentication token for using web services by introducing the Manage Access Keys option. Customers and partners can now generate access keys from the MaaS360 Portal without any intervention. Customers and partners can use this access key to generate an OAuth token.
Generate Access Key option
From Manage Access Keys. The manage access keys option is available for customer and partner accounts with the Web Service-Access Keys access right only. Administrators can enable this access right for the customer and partner account from the Roles page. For more information about managing roles, see Access roles and rights for portal administrators.
, selectIn the Manage Access Keys page, use Generate Access Key to create a new access key. You can choose from the following three options to generate an access key:
- MaaS360 Web Services: Use this option to quickly generate an access key to get an authentication token. Enter a Key Name that uniquely identifies this key in the future.
- App Access Key: Use this option if you know the app ID, device platform, and version. Enter the Key Name, choose iOS or Android Platform ID, App ID, and Version.
- Cisco ISE Integration: Use this option to allow Cisco ISE Integration to use the MaaS360 Web Services API. Enter a Key Name that uniquely identifies this key in the future.
Click Generate to complete access key generation. The access key that is generated is listed in the Manage Access Keys page.
Manage Access Keys page
Option | Description |
---|---|
Key name | Unique name that identifies the access key. |
AppID | The identifier that uniquely represents the app that is associated with the key name. |
Status | Defines whether the access key is active or inactive. |
Last modified by | Specifies the customer or partner account username who last modified the access key. |
Last modified on | The date in Coordinated Universal Time (UTC) format that specifies when the access key was last modified. |
